OnChainAI: "AI for Smart Contracts"
OnChainAI is a decentralized platform that integrates AI with blockchain technology.
This on-chain protocol enables any smart contract to make AI requests. It leverages AI via Chainlink Functions, where each AI request is processed by multiple Chainlink nodes, which reach consensus before delivering a unique response.
Responses may take over a minute depending on the network. On mainnet, these requests needs LINK tokens and OpenAI fees, so OnChainAI protocol requires a fixed cost of 0.0001 ETH per request.
The fundamental distinction of OnChainAI lies in the direction of interaction: smart contracts trigger AI processes, whereas in most other platforms, the AI calls the blockchain.
OnChainAI Toolkit
OnChainAI provides developers with tools to integrate AI models into blockchain applications.
OnChainAI comes in two flavors:
- OnChainAI Template: Available as a GitHub template, built with Scaffold-eth-alt.
- OnChainAI Extension: Available as an Extension for Scaffold-eth-2.
You can use pre-deployed contracts or deploy your own with customizable settings, including pricing.
These two Dapps created with OnChainAI are already available:
- Ask? OnChainAI: Use OnChainAI Chat to ask any question and get your answer on-chain.
- OnChainAI Verify!: With the Contract Verifier, check any new token before interacting with it on-chain.
Links Dapps
OnChainAI Toolkit History
-
applied to the GG22 OSS - Developer Tooling and Libraries 3 weeks ago which was rejected